    Delicious food and friendly service. It's the same owners and recipes as the one in Murray (which was worth the long drive!). Our favorites are the dumplings and the steak with sticky rice. Their house made sauces are delicious. And the ambiance is small and quiet and peaceful.

    Interesting that Panda Express is just across the street and that there is an Asian noodle house…read moreonly four doors down. But I would recommend this over Panda Express. This is a mom & pop shop and a pretty good one at that. We had the Teriyaki chicken, beef and broccoli, and General Tso's chicken. All were good. I would have like more flavor with the teriyaki as it was a bit weak for my tastes, but still not bad. Same for the General Tso's chicken gravy. All the meats were tender and the veggies cooked just right. You have the choice of steamed rice, fried rice, or noodles with your combo meals. We choose two with noodles and one with fried rice. The noodles are better than Panda Express and are not greasy. The fried rice is not much to talk about, but was good enough. The cheese wontons are extremely good.
